Show description: On October 30, 2025 the Czech National Bank board approved and publicly disclosed a roughly $1 million purchase of Bitcoin and selected other digital assets as a ring‑fenced pilot under the CNB Lab innovation program. The purchase was executed outside the bank's international reserves and was described as a controlled experiment to build practical competence across the digital asset lifecycle. The pilot covers wallet setup and administration, custody controls and key management, valuation and accounting for continuously priced assets, settlement and reconciliation processes, and internal reporting subject to risk, compliance, and audit review. The program is governed and publicly reported with structured oversight and defined milestones. The CNB stated the objective is operational learning and process validation and not a change to reserve management policy. CNB Lab covers AI research, future payment systems, and digital asset pilots, and the bank said findings will inform supervision, examination procedures, and policymaking. The CNB described the purchase as the first public disclosure of a direct Bitcoin purchase by any central bank and said the exposure is intentionally small and immaterial to its balance sheet. The announcement identified accounting, cybersecurity, custody architecture, incident response, access segregation, continuity planning, and audit documentation as areas for supervisor and auditor scrutiny. The CNB said it expects to publish controls testing outcomes and audit findings in coming quarters, and observers should monitor any expansion of the pilot, changes in reserve reporting classification, formal vendor and custody model selections, and links between the pilot and central bank digital currency or payment system trials. Source: https://theweb3.news/crypto/cnb-first-public-crypto-purchase/ Hosted on Acast.
